Ordinals
beta
Sat 765780509295392
decimal
153156.509295392
degree
0°153156′1956″509295392‴
percentile
36.46573857798814%
name
iksbwqdrkij
cycle
0
epoch
0
period
75
block
153156
offset
509295392
timestamp
2011-11-13 21:20:42 UTC
rarity
common
prev
next